Ingredients
- 32 grams β 1.12oz almond flour
- 8 grams β 0.3g of coconut flour
- 1 tbsp. β 15ml golden flaxseed meal
- 1/4 tsp. β 1.2ml leaven
- 1/8 tsp. β 0.6ml kosher salt
- 42 grams β 1.4oz grass-butter or coconut butter,
- 2-3 large Spoon LaMotte. Preferred Sweetener (we use 2tbsp)
- 1/4 tsp. β 1.2ml vanilla
- 30g β 1oz lily Sweet Prickly Chocolate Bar Flaky (or chips)
- 20g β 0.7oz pecans Flaky
Method
- Garnish dry pan with light almond flour toast over medium heat, until completely golden (2β4 minutes).
- Transfer to a plate and allow to cool completely. This is often important taste-wise, so don't skip it!
- Prepare a little pie plate (about 4 inches / 11 cm diameter) or ramekin. The cocoa tends to stay, so if you are not eating it directly from the dish, grease, and butter (or line).
- n a small bowl, add toasted almond flour, coconut flour, flaxseed, leaven, and salt. Keep aside until fully combined.
- Cream butter with sweetener in a medium bowl with an electric mixer until light and fluffy, scraping the edges and bottom for 3-4 minutes. Add the vanilla and mix until fully incorporated.
- With your mixer on low speed, add half of your flour mixture β mixing until just incorporated. Mix with the rest.
- Add in chocolate and pecan bits. Press into the prepared baking dish and chill within the freezer for 20 minutes.
- Preheat the oven to 350 Β° F / 180 Β° C, while the cocoa pie is inside the freezer. Bake for 15-18 minutes until it just starts to turn brown.
- Be happy to spoon it hot (right away from the dish!) With a generous scoop of Vanilla frozen dessert.
- Alternatively, allow it to cool completely so that the cocoa pie is slightly crispy with the edges. Store in an airtight container for 3 days (if any remaining!).
